Unfortunately i've no idea what he's doing.
He also did the papercuts for a 6th deck called "Fashion & Flair" and even startet a 7th in January 2017.
Somehow he stopped working/posting about that 7th deck and shows only pet portraits for almost a year.
The way he integrates the pips in his desings are incredible, i love his work and hope that he is going to print these decks one day.

He’s actually pretty easily found, just not doing playing cards anymore it seems...or at least having them printed, which is a shame as he does do amazing work.

The decks that were printed are: Curator, Clipped Wings, Sawdust and Delicious ;)

I am generally not really into transformation or semi-transformation decks. So, when I first saw EJ's "Clipped Wings" deck for sale on HOPC (back in the day), it was an easy pass. Yet, people here at UC kept raving about his decks. So, later, when Sawdust or Delicious came out (I'm not sure of the order), I bought *one*. For most projects, I buy a few (as the saying goes, one to open and play with, one for the collection, and one... just because.) Well, I bought one, and... it blew me away.

Still, when the next one came out (the other one of the pair I mentioned above), I bought only one again. Not sure why I only bought one that time. I guess I figured that I'd never play with it, so since I would already have one (opened, granted), that was good enough for the collection. Yeah.

Sooo, anywho, now they are super rare and super in demand and I don't even have one spare to use as trade bait. And, it stands to reason that they are in demand: they are truly awesome.

EJ opened up my eyes to the possibilities of semi-transformation decks. *Most* such decks still don't grab me, but as has been previously mentioned, Natalia Silva and Elephant Playing Cards (the Pipmen series) have a similar kind of whimsy and cleverness that grabs me enough to make me pick them up whenever there's a new one.

I do hope that Emmanuel returns to the playing card fold. His work is a genuine treasure.
